To achieve the best visual quality with AI enhancement, start with the highest quality source visuals. These visuals should be well-lit and free from excessive noise or compression artifacts, as such issues can significantly hinder the enhancement process. Conventional enlargement techniques often lead to blurry or distorted visuals. Therefore, applying preprocessing methods like noise reduction and sharpening is essential to improve clarity and detail before utilizing AI enhancement. For example, reducing noise helps preserve fine details, while sharpening enhances edges, resulting in a more defined final output.
AI upscalers analyze millions of high- and low-resolution picture pairs to learn intricate details, emphasizing the significance of beginning with superior visuals for image ai upscale. Experimenting with different scaling factors and settings within your chosen upscaling tool is crucial for achieving optimal outcomes tailored to your specific visuals. Regularly reviewing results and adjusting your approach based on performance metrics and feedback will facilitate continuous improvement in the quality of your upscaled images.
